EVALUATION OF ULTIMATE DISPOSAL METHODS FOR LIQUID AND SOLID RADIOACTIVE WASTES. PART II. CONVERSION TO SOLID BY POT CALCINATION

Description: The costs of pot calcination of Purex and Thorex wastes were calculated. The wastes were assumed produced by a plant processing 1500 ton/year of U converter fuel at a burnup of 10,000 Mwd/ton and 270 ton/year of Th converter fuel at 20,000 Mwd/ton. Costs were calculated for processing Purex waste in acidic and reacidified forms and for processing Thorex wastes in acidic and reacidified forms and with constituents added for producing an acidic Thorex glass. Engineering design of a liquid metal cooled self-pumped limiter for a tokamak reactor

Description: A lithium cooled self-pumped limiter has been designed as the impurity control system for the TPSS high-..beta.. power reactor conceptual design. The limiter removes helium by trapping impinging helium ions in freshly deposited vanadium surface layers in a slot region. No hydrogen is removed and no pumps or vacuum penetrations are used, thereby eliminating penetration shielding and reducing tritium handling. Evaluation of self-interaction parameters from binary phase diagrams

Description: The feasibility of calculating Wagner self-interaction parameters from binary phase diagrams was examined. The self-interaction parameters of 22 non-ferrous liquid solutions were calculated utilizing an equation based on the equality of the chemical potentials of a component in two equilibrium phases. Utilization of the equation requires the evaluation of the first and second derivatives of various liquidus and solidus data at infinite dilution of the solute component.
